    Quote Originally Posted by Jason Miller View Post
    This looks like a real good product. So Seb, you can set where you want the boost curve at and the computer makes the ramps?

    Yes no more ramps all done automatically. Put the dot or dots where ya want them and go! 1/10 of a psi resolution and 1 hundreth of a second in time.

    In shift based you have 6 graphs. Each graphs is associated with a gear. On the bottom is time and then target pressure up on the left. Draw your curve for each gear!

    Oh there is so much more as well

    This unit is a datalogger as well.
